Barking Dogs: Apex vs Cary

How do barking dogs rules compare between Apex, NC and Cary, NC?

Apex and Cary have similar restriction levels.

Apex, NC

Wake County

Some Restrictions

Apex regulates animal noise through two parallel provisions: Chapter 4 (Animals) makes it unlawful for any dog owner to keep a dog that 'habitually or repeatedly barks' in such a manner that it is a public nuisance, and Sec. 14-33 of the noise ordinance separately prohibits 'the keeping of any animal or bird which by causing frequent or long continued noise shall disturb the comfort and repose of any person in the vicinity.' Field response is shared between Apex Police and Wake County Animal Services.

Cary, NC

Wake County

Some Restrictions

Cary's noise ordinance covers barking dogs under the general prohibition on disturbing noises. Persistently barking dogs that disturb neighbors may result in animal control complaints and citations.

Apex FAQ

How do I report a barking dog in Apex, NC?

Call Apex Police non-emergency dispatch at 919-362-8661 - they decide whether to send Apex Police or refer to Wake County Animal Services (the Town's contracted animal-control provider). Provide the property address, dog description, dates and times of barking, and (if possible) audio or video evidence. Apex Town Code Chapter 4 and Sec. 14-33 don't require a sound-meter reading - officers evaluate whether the barking is habitual or repeated, frequent or long continued, and whether it disturbs neighbors' comfort and repose.

What counts as a barking nuisance in Apex?

Apex Town Code Chapter 4 (Animals) makes it unlawful to keep any dog that 'habitually or repeatedly barks' in such a manner that it constitutes a public nuisance, and Sec. 14-33 of the noise ordinance independently prohibits any animal that 'by causing frequent or long continued noise shall disturb the comfort and repose of any person in the vicinity.' There is no fixed minute-threshold; pattern documentation across multiple days carries more weight than a single short episode. Violations are misdemeanors under N.C.G.S. 14-4.

Cary FAQ

How do I report a barking dog in Cary, NC?

Contact Cary Animal Control. Document the dates, times, and duration of barking to support your complaint.

Can I be cited for my dog's barking in Cary?

Yes. Persistent barking that disturbs neighbors is a noise violation. You may receive a warning first, then citations with fines for continued violations.
